Recycled water flows at a busy Veterinary Clinic and Hospital
The Veterinary Clinic and Hospital operates like a large veterinary practice employing over 40 registered veterinarians from interns to senior veterinary registrars. Each year, about 17,000 animals – from horses to dogs and cats – are seen in the Veterinary Clinic and Hospital, which is open to the community 24 hours a day seven days a week.
We commenced supply of recycled water to the Faculty of Veterinary Science in August 2007. It is now used extensively throughout the site for cleaning animal enclosures, wash down and to ensure the surrounding gardens are kept in great shape. We expect the site will eventually use up to 24 million litres of recycled water a year.
